The 1983-1992 third generation steering brace, also known as the Wonder Bar, is designed to tie the front right and left subframe together. This tubular set-up bolts directly under the front sway bar, stiffening the front frame, resulting in improved handling, cornering and overall performance. The steering brace strengthens the chassis, taking stress from the steering box area which is well known as a weak area on any third generation F-Body. Steering brace is constructed of 0.250" 1018 mild steel CNC machined mounting points, 1.250" DOM steel tubing with a 0.120" wall fully MIG welded for extreme strength and lasting performance.

UMI Performance Tubular Frame and Steering Braces are manufactured using 1-1/4" DOM steel tubing with precision cut steel mounting brackets for extreme strength and lasting performance. They are designed to tie the front right and left subframes together adding rigidity to the chassis as well as reducing steering gear movement. The braces bolt directly under the front sway bar to stiffen the front frame for improved handling, cornering and performance. The UMI Performance Tubular Frame and Steering Braces use the factory sway bar mounting points, OEM hardware and will work with OEM sway bar bushings or aftermarket poly mounts for an easy bolt-on installation with no drilling. 100% designed and manufactured with pride in Philipsburg, PA U.S.A.!
